US Chip Supply Challenge is a Case for Strong Taiwan Ties

BGA Taiwan Managing Director Rupert Hammond-Chambers wrote a recent commentary in The Wall Street Journal on the computer chip supply issue experienced by American auto makers and how the challenge is a case for stronger ties with Taiwan, rather than casting blame on the U.S. ally. The piece, titled “A Chip Problem of Detroit’s Own Making,” was published on March 4.
